Consul-General Kenny to the Marquess of Lansdowne,*--(Received September 12.)
Manila, September 12, 1905.
(Telegraphic.) En clair.
YOUR Lordship's despatch of the 4th August. "Raffineries locales" probably mean Hong Kong, as no sugar is refined here at present, and Iloilo sugar is nearly all exported to China and Hong Kong.
